MICHIE, District Judge.
This suit was instituted by the United States of America to recover from the original defendants, Louis B. Houff, Jr. and C. E. Keefer, now defendants and third-party plaintiffs but hereinafter sometimes called the Guarantors, a balance due on a loan made by the Small Business Administration, hereinafter called S. B. A., to Famous Virginia Foods Corporation, hereinafter called Famous Foods, now bankrupt, and guaranteed by the Guarantors.
